Clinical Medicine for Optometrists
Author: David Shein
Publisher: Lippincott Williams & Wilkins
ISBN: 1975146549
Category : Medical
Languages : en
Pages : 780
Book Description
Providing a solid foundation in clinical medicine for optometrists and optometry students, Clinical Medicine for Optometrists covers the systemic medical conditions that have serious impacts on ocular health and function, as well as the ocular exam findings that may be an early indication of significant systemic disease. This unique text explains important medical considerations for optometric practice, meeting the needs of clinical medicine courses in optometry programs, and also serving as a practical reference for optometrists in practice.
